当前位置: 首页 > news >正文

19、将 Snort 规则转换为 iptables 规则

将 Snort 规则转换为 iptables 规则

在网络安全领域,我们常常需要使用入侵检测和预防系统来保障网络的安全。Snort 是一款知名的入侵检测系统(IDS),而 iptables 则是 Linux 系统中常用的防火墙工具。将 Snort 规则转换为 iptables 规则,能够结合两者的优势,增强网络的安全性。下面我们来详细探讨相关内容。

深度防御

入侵检测系统本身也可能成为攻击目标,攻击手段多种多样,从试图通过制造误报来破坏 IDS 的警报机制,到利用 IDS 中的漏洞进行代码执行。例如,攻击者可以通过 Tor 网络发送真实或伪造的攻击,使攻击看起来来自与自身网络无关的 IP 地址。此外,入侵检测系统偶尔也会出现远程可利用的漏洞,如 Snort 的 DCE/RPC 预处理器漏洞(详情见:http://www.snort.org/docs/advisory - 2007 - 02 - 19.html)。

深度防御原则不仅适用于传统的计算机系统(服务器和桌面设备),也适用于防火墙和入侵检测系统等安全基础设施。因此,有必要用额外的机制来补充现有的入侵检测/预防系统。

基于目标的入侵检测和网络层分片重组

在 IDS 中构建能够结合终端主机特征来增强检测操作的功能,被称为基于目标的入侵检测。例如,Snort IDS 通过 frag3 预处理器提供网络层分片重组功能,它可以对分片的网络流量应用各种数据包分片重组算法(包括 Linux、BSD、Windows 和 Solaris IP 栈中的算法)。这很有用,因为它能让 Snort 应用与目标主机相同的分片重组算法。如果针对 Windows 系统发送了一个分片攻击,但 Snort 用 Linux IP

http://www.gsyq.cn/news/89269.html

相关文章:

  • 教程 29 - 从磁盘加载纹理
  • 20、深入理解Snort规则选项与iptables数据包过滤
  • FPGA教程系列-Vivado Aurora 8B/10B 例程解读
  • 基于SpringBoot的大学生在线考试平台的设计与实现毕业设计项目源码
  • 003-RSA魔改:一号店
  • Jeecg AI开源平台:零门槛构建AI应用的完整指南
  • 与AI共舞:当代大学生如何在智能时代重塑学习与成长
  • 【题解】Luogu P1310 [NOIP 2011 普及组] 表达式的值
  • Flink学习笔记:状态类型和应用
  • 2025贵阳公墓/公益公墓top5推荐!贵阳优质生态陵园榜单发布,合规保障与人文关怀兼具的安息之所推荐 - 全局中转站
  • AI核心知识50——大语言模型之Scaling Laws(简洁且通俗易懂版)
  • MySQL 深分页查询优化实践与经验总结
  • 电机多目标优化与灵敏度分析:探索电机性能提升之道
  • 打造下一个爆款!专业短剧APP全栈开发解决方案,解锁万亿级市场红利
  • 毕业论文选题AI推荐:9大工具+热门方向合集
  • C51_AH3144霍尔传感器
  • 16 位 SAR ADC 逐次逼近型 ADC 模拟集成电路设计探秘
  • 5 分钟快速入门 Gitlab CI/CD
  • 【题解】Luogu P13885 [蓝桥杯 2023 省 Java/Python A] 反异或 01 串
  • 【笔记】Manacher
  • 电动汽车永磁同步电机的电磁设计与最优控制探索
  • 【题解】Luogu B4185 [中山市赛 2024/科大国创杯小学组 2023] 倍数子串/子串
  • 5 分钟快速入门 Github Actions
  • 虚函数虚表
  • 已有析音法
  • 告别排版困境!AI 写作到发布全自动化的完整方案
  • Docker 两大基石:Namespace 和 Cgroups
  • 9、Eclipse集成开发环境:C/C++开发全流程指南
  • Python银行客户数据流失预测SMOTE平衡数据实现神经网络、SVM、决策树、随机森林与超参数调优|附代码数据
  • 享搭提醒助手:数据变动实时预警,运营者业务状态“尽在掌握”